Default Weird Request - 70 to 120 mph run times?

So, like the title says, I have a weird request. My car is a Trans Am A4 w/3.23's, I have added a whisper lid/holley filter, corsa cat-back, and MSD wires. I don't know if I am just jaded to my cars performance or if something is wrong with my car but it feels slow above 80 mph. What I would like from some of you guys (with as close to my car as you can get) is to time a 70-120 run for me so I can compare it with mine. Thanks a bunch.

I have a data-logged run that has me 70-120mph at 7.8sec. This seems a little too high- could have been a slight downhill : With a high 11sec 1/4 (@around 114-115). I figure about 0.7 sec extra for the 115-120... My 0-60 on sticky tires I have logged at around 3.3sec, call it 4sec for 70mph, so say 11.8 +0.7 =12.5 -4=8.5. You've asked others, what are you getting for 70-120 ?
